Transaction 64d8386c941ca5105e338d058964a1d2fa8e38e38fd8d96482c48ace0ab74b07

1 Input
2 Outputs
  • 64d8386c941ca5105e338d058964a1d2fa8e38e38fd8d96482c48ace0ab74b07:0
  • value  38530552
    address  1HV5ggKSnqtpGbtWjbCdTgphzg1mDQTmtB
  • 64d8386c941ca5105e338d058964a1d2fa8e38e38fd8d96482c48ace0ab74b07:1
  • value  17954702
    address  1P51MwNLGYZPyyaYrVajwWhDcwrdxKFW1d